I need some advice regarding the behaviour of Real-Time Process Explorer & the CPU load reading.
From the image below CPU load is showing 100% while in the same time my reading from real-time process explorer did not show any spike on CPU usage, how do I able to pin point the culprit processes which are using up the server's CPU?
The monitored value of CPU is just when orion polls the CPU info from the node.
Realtime is... real time. It shows the value all the time.
Sometimes it is the polling that spiked the CPU on the node. Try restart om WMI service to see if that helps.
